#7FAD84 Color
#7FAD84 is rgb(127, 173, 132) in RGB, hsl(127, 22%, 59%) in HSL, and about cmyk(27%, 0%, 24%, 32%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Sea Green (#8FBC8F),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.83.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#7FAD84 Channel Values
How #7FAD84 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 127 · G 173 · B 132 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 127° · S 22% · L 59%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 127° · S 27% · V 68%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 27% · M 0% · Y 24% · K 32%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.56:1 vs white · 8.21: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#7FAD84 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#7FAD84 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#7FAD84?
#7FAD84 is a mid-tone green — rgb(127, 173, 132) in RGB and hsl(127, 22%, 59%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Sea Green (#8FBC8F),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.83.
What is the RGB value of #7FAD84?
#7FAD84 is rgb(127, 173, 132) — red 127, green 173, and blue 132 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#7FAD84?
#7FAD84 converts to approximately cmyk(27%, 0%, 24%, 32%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#7FAD84 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#7FAD84 scores 2.56:1 against white and 8.21: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#7FAD84 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#7FAD84 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kseagreen (#8FBC8F) at a CIE76 distance of 5.83,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
